At that time the Land Rover ignition switch was playing up & I fitted a start button which I liked & I had another push to make switch that would drop into the black hole.
And so I’ve been push buttoning since.
In recent years all my cars & those I have access to (excluding those classics I am privileged to drive) have push starters & there all pretty well in the same place; where the wing mirror joystick is in the MG. The other day having tried to start the thing three times by adjusting the wing mirrors I relocated the start switch & I’m delighted to say I haven’t missed the switch in its previous home.
As an aside; I had a spare joystick which I stripped to mount the push button, they are a brilliant bit of design but if yours fails don’t try & repair it , by the time you’ve got into the full works it’s broken.
